Acquiring In-Depth Knowledge About Carpal Tunnel Syndrome

Carpal tunnel syndrome (CTS) is a common condition characterized by a range of uncomfortable sensations in the hand and arm. This disorder arises when the median nerve, which runs through the carpal tunnel in the wrist, becomes compressed due to various factors. This compression can lead to symptoms that significantly interfere with daily tasks, ultimately diminishing your overall quality of life. Identifying Common Symptoms Associated with Carpal Tunnel Syndrome

Individuals suffering from carpal tunnel syndrome frequently report a distressing array of symptoms, which may include:

– Continuous pain radiating from the wrist into the hand.
Numbness or tingling sensations that extend into the fingers.
– Noticeable weakness in grip strength, making simple actions such as holding objects increasingly difficult.

These symptoms can severely disrupt sleep patterns and daily activities, prompting many to seek effective solutions such as acupuncture for carpal tunnel relief to regain control of their lives and boost their overall well-being. Exploring the Causes and Risk Factors Associated with Carpal Tunnel Syndrome

Anatomical illustration of wrist with carpal tunnel syndrome, showing nerve compression and related risk factors.

Understanding the root causes of carpal tunnel syndrome is essential for developing effective treatment and prevention strategies. Several prevalent risk factors can contribute to the onset of this condition, including:

Repetitive hand use: Activities requiring prolonged wrist flexion, such as typing or assembly line work, can significantly increase the risk of developing CTS.
Wrist injuries: Previous trauma to the wrist can heighten the likelihood of nerve compression and subsequent symptoms.
Health conditions: Certain medical issues, including diabetes, rheumatoid arthritis, and thyroid disorders, may also elevate the chances of developing CTS.

Identifying Effective Acupuncture Points for Carpal Tunnel Syndrome Relief

Diagram of arm showing acupuncture points for carpal tunnel relief: inner forearm, hand, outer forearm.

Several specific acupuncture points have shown remarkable effectiveness in delivering acupuncture for carpal tunnel relief. Key points include:

PC6 (Neiguan): Located on the inner forearm, this point is renowned for alleviating wrist pain.
LI4 (Hegu): Situated on the hand, this point is widely recognized for its potent pain-relieving properties.
TH5 (Waiguan): Found on the outer forearm, this point is effective in reducing inflammation.

Focusing on these crucial points can enhance blood circulation and relieve nerve pressure, effectively addressing the symptoms associated with carpal tunnel syndrome and promoting significant relief and well-being.

Addressing Common Questions About Acupuncture for Carpal Tunnel Syndrome

What Is the Recommended Frequency of Acupuncture Sessions for Optimal Relief?

Typically, a range of 6-12 sessions is suggested for achieving considerable relief; however, the exact number may vary based on the severity of symptoms and individual responses to treatment.

Is the Acupuncture Procedure Painful for Patients?

Most patients experience minimal discomfort during acupuncture sessions, often describing the sensation as a slight prick or mild tingling, which is generally well-tolerated and quickly fades.

Can Acupuncture Completely Cure Carpal Tunnel Syndrome?

While acupuncture may not provide a complete cure for carpal tunnel syndrome, it can significantly alleviate symptoms and enhance overall well-being, making it a valuable component of a comprehensive treatment plan.

Are There Any Potential Side Effects Associated with Acupuncture Treatment?

Side effects are rare; however, they may include bruising or soreness at the needle insertion sites, which typically resolves quickly following treatment, ensuring a comfortable experience for patients.

How Long Can I Expect the Results of Acupuncture to Last?

The duration of results can vary; however, many patients report enjoying long-term relief, particularly with regular maintenance sessions to sustain the benefits of their treatment.
